A French Walnut Arm Chair

19th century
Description

A French walnut arm chair on turned and stop fluted legs and with carved moldings and patera which have original gilt high-lighting. The chair has just been re-upholstered. 960mm high, 750mm wide, 640mm deep and 470mm seat height. French. Circe 1870.

Louis XVI style seating emerged in the late 18th century, transitioning away from Rococo curves toward Neoclassical geometry. Key characteristics include straight lines, symmetrical frames, fluted tapering legs, and motifs inspired by Greco-Roman antiquity.

Frames were primarily crafted from solid hardwoods such as walnut, beech, or oak, often finished with gilding, paint, or natural polish. Upholstery traditionally incorporated horsehair, webbed foundations, and silk, velvet, or linen coverings.

Authentic period pieces display evidence of hand-carved joinery, peg construction, stop-fluting on legs, and hand-chiseled decorative blocks. Frame undersides usually reveal hand-sawn timber marks and age-appropriate wear to the gilding or finish.

Clean the woodwork regularly using a dry, soft microfibre cloth or light feather duster to prevent dust build-up. Keep the item away from direct sunlight, central heating sources, and excess humidity to prevent the timber from warping or the gilding from flaking.
